Paddy Lowe: important to understand safety concerns

Related Topics: Paddy Lowe

Williams chief technical officer Paddy Lowe has stressed the importance of understanding and respecting the safety concerns behind the decision to abandon second practice for the Chinese Grand Prix.

Following limited running in a rain-hit first session -- which had to be postponed on two occasions because the medical helicopter was unable to operate -- the second session was abandoned on safety grounds as a result of smog and low cloud surrounding the nearest hospital in Shanghai, meaning the helicopter could not land.

Lowe insists that while the lack of on-track action was frustrating for Formula One teams and fans alike, it is crucial to understand the reasoning behind the decision to abandon the session.
